Transaction ccae381877235f5383facb61ab71e019eb435c92f40999139f291249ddd848a7
1 Input
1 Output
-
ccae381877235f5383facb61ab71e019eb435c92f40999139f291249ddd848a7:0
- value
- 974827
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c5ae3a5b8b34e382639e1144669fdde2f3d6f19 OP_EQUAL
- address
- 3LKYemmu5VoSJrsLbGdKwb644vzfbaWFS1